Job Description

Manufacturing Engineering Specialist (Powertrain Machining) 3.9 3.9 out of 5 stars Auburn Hills, MI 48326 Stellantis 9,706 reviews The Industrial Strategy (IS) Powertrain (PWT) Machining Systems Product/Process Specialist will lead projects in design and cost estimation of Machining systems for Engines as indicated by requirements in the Long Range Plan. This will include Machining/Automation/Facilities and all other equipment for new model launches in North America, Canada, and Mexico. The role of this Manager will be to apply Process Standards developed by the Underbody Process Engineering (UPE) group to develop proposals for new product introductions, including process design, layout, and cost estimations (Capital, Tooling, and Expense). Job responsibilities include but are not limited to: The IS Engine Machining Specialist will be responsible for the application of UPE standards and specifications focused on: Developing Process Cost Estimates Developing Initial Labor/Manpower Estimates Developing Concept Layouts and Representations Performing Product Feasibility Analyses Identifying DTM Opportunities to improve key KPI's (Cost, Quality, and Throughput) Preparation of process proposal documents for handoff to UPE team for execution after governance of program
